Transaction 63656afc07fd71d1f80ef55186c8588d3a1be5f88193c06a6f37282482e3b911
1 Input
1 Output
-
63656afc07fd71d1f80ef55186c8588d3a1be5f88193c06a6f37282482e3b911: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 c25647d55b25d6bba46165c8073584c1b0176761a8e7663f590fa97ca385221e
- address
- bc1pcfty042myhtthfrpvhyqwdvycxcpwemp4rnkv06ep75hegu9yg0qqve7nr